Azerbaijan's ACG Oil Field Maintains Stable Production Levels

The Azeri-Chirag-Gunashli (ACG) oil field in Azerbaijan has maintained stable production levels, according to a report from BP Azerbaijan. The block produced around 59 million barrels of oil in the first half of 2026, which is almost unchanged compared to the same period last year.

Average daily production decreased by 1.2% to 323,000 barrels per day, with some platforms experiencing slight changes. Central Azeri production increased to 88,000 barrels, while West Azeri output declined to 73,300 barrels. East Azeri production rose to 45,000 barrels, and Deepwater Gunashli output fell to 47,000 barrels.

Project spending in the first half of 2026 totaled $1.001 billion, a 22.7% increase compared to the same period last year. Operating expenses increased by 3.5% to $268 million, while capital expenditures rose by 31.6% to $733 million.

During the reporting period, seven oil production wells, three water injection wells, and two gas injection wells were drilled and completed at ACG.
